Exercise
You may love or hate exercise, but exercise is actually a very powerful way to move toxins out of your body and to release negative emotions. When we exercise we naturally increase the amount of oxygen we breathe in, allowing our cells to regenerate. When we breathe out we release carbon dioxide, toxins and waste. Our heart rate, blood circulation and sweat production also increases, which all assist the body in removing toxins. Exercise helps to improve our digestion and elimination process which increases the amount of waste our body gets rid of. Exercise is also great for our mental health because it reduces stress and releases the ‘feel good hormones’ serotonin, endorphins and dopamine. This is why you feel so good after making your body move and it can actually become addictive!

Dry Skin Brushing
Similar to giving yourself a massage, dry skin brushing is a great way to detoxify your body. Using a soft, natural bristle brush to brush in a circular motion, starting at your hands and feet moving towards your heart. Regular skin brushing can help stimulate the lymphatic system, which is very important in removing toxins and waste from the body. This can help reduce inflammation and promote overall detoxification as well as improving blood circulation, which can help deliver nutrients to the skin and promote a healthy glow. Some people even claim that skin brushing can help break up cellulite deposits and improve the appearance of dimpled skin. Regardless of whether or not it gets rid of cellulite, skin brushing is very relaxing and therapeutic, helping to reduce stress and promote a sense of well-being.
